Output 52c816723557bdbb9f38079635cd8ea187f8f2769b39adac021acde071bc5d20:0

value
23050990
script pubkey
OP_0 OP_PUSHBYTES_20 75cde5dc571833e5ed1ea052af48664f9b93f1dc
address
bc1qwhx7thzhrqe7tmg75pf27jrxf7de8uwuc8j06w
transaction
52c816723557bdbb9f38079635cd8ea187f8f2769b39adac021acde071bc5d20
spent
true